If Wilmington Christian Academy was feeling good fresh off their 78-48 takedown of Norfolk Christian on Friday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Patriots fell 68-64 to the Atlantic Shores Christian Seahawks on Saturday. The loss put an end to the Patriots' undefeated start to the season.

Despite the loss, Wilmington Christian Academy saw an underclassman step up: sophomore Trent Davies shot 44% from the field en route to 29 points along with six assists and three steals. The matchup was Davies' fourth in a row with at least 26 points. Ryan McConekey was another key player, going 6-for-9 to rack up 13 points and six boards.
Having lost for the first time this season, Wilmington Christian Academy fell to 2-1.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ming contests. Wilmington Christian Academy will challenge Epiphany at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. As for Atlantic Shores Christian, they are packing up and heading out for their first away game of the season: they will face off against Mercersburg Academy at 1:30 p.m. on Saturday.
